Hakan

SSFIV-Hakan Face.jpg

Hakan has made a fortune by becoming the president of the world's leading cooking oil manufacturer. He also gained fame and prominence in his expertise in Yagli Gures, the Turkish sport of oil wrestling. Hakan has made numerous friends due to his lively personality (including sumo wrestler Edmond Honda) is married to a beautiful wife, and has a family of seven daughters. So what else is there for such a man to do? Enter the world of Street Fighting for the fun of it, to promote the joys of oil wrestling, and to make his family proud.


In a nutshell

Hakan is certainly an oddball in the Street Fighter universe. Hakan is a grappler, but his gimmick is that he requires being in Oil Mode to make good use of his grapples. He essentially has two fighting styles - Oil Mode, and Non-Oil Mode, the latter of which being how you start the round. When not oiled, your main objective with Hakan is getting the opponent in a position where you can enter Oil Mode. To that end, he has several excellent non-grapple related tools to knock your opponent down or otherwise incapacitate them. Upon entering Oil Mode, the fun really begins. Hakan gets a major boost in mobility and power, which is actually the main reason his grapples are not so good when not oiled. During Oil Mode, he is also the only character who can move during his Focus Attack, which is another very useful and deadly tool of his. Hakan's gimmicky playstyle is also, sadly, his weakness. The problem with Hakan does not lie with himself, but rather every other character just outshines him in almost every way. Like Dan, however, Hakan is a character full of surprises, and that element is always an advantage in the world of Street Fighter.

AE Changes

  • Standing Hard Punch's hittable box around his arm got smaller, so it's easier to use as an anti air attack or a poke.
  • When Oiled, normal moves buffered after a forward dash now have sliding property.
  • Step Low (F + Light Kick) is now cancelable, has a faster startup, can link from Close Standing Medium Punch and other attacks.
  • For Oil Shower, the duration of the oil will be stacked now. The maximum duration is 30 seconds. Also, the Medium, Hard and EX versions of the Oil Shower have 5 frames less recovery time, and the EX version can be canceled into Guard Position.
  • Oil Shower is one of Hakan's follow ups after an Oil Slide. The effect is the same as Light Kick Oil Shower, and he will be in advantage nevertheless.
  • Light Punch Oil Slide has a faster startup, and can be connected from Crouching Light Punch or Step Low (F + Light Kick).
  • Oil Dive, including the EX version, while holding button, can be canceled into Guard Position (Coward Crouch), you can now use it as a feint and to build meter.
  • Oil Rocket and Oil Dive's input property is adjusted, so the feeling will be same with that of Zangief's Spinning Piledriver.
